This probably doesn't belong in this thread, except for it being another 'cool' implementation coming from non-SWG source material:
At the end of ANH, Vader's TIE Advanced protype had an important design feature that was missing in both the Larry Holland sims and in this game. That being: the guns on the Advanced functioned as forward facing turrets that were controllable by the pilot.
Controlling the forward turrets would probably most easily be implemented by allowing an alternate configuration for the POV hat that comes standard on most joysticks these days (which, in personal experience, hasn't proven very useful in JTL), and adjusting the targeting reticle accordingly. It still would be incredibly tricky for a pilot to get a handle on, but someone mastering such an enhancement would be incredibly fun to watch and fight.
